deskutils/fyi: new port
FYI (for your information) is a command line utility to send desktop
notifications to the user via a notification daemon implementing XDG desktop
notifications.
It is a almost a notify-send clone, with the following differences:
* notify-send does not implement --close.
* notify-send does not expose activation tokens (needed for window
focus/activation) in any meaningful way. It prints it as a debug message when
G_MESSAGES_DEBUG=all; fyi prints it when you use --print-token.
* fyi has consistent syntax in its --action and --hintoptions.
* fyi can print the reason a notification was closed, with --print-reason.
* fyi can query the notification daemon for its name and version information.
* fyi can query the notification daemon for its capabilities.
* fyi has shell completions (bash and fish).
* fyi has a single run-time dependency: dbus.

deskutils/py-trash-cli: Add new port
trash-cli trashes files recording the original path, deletion date, and
permissions. It uses the same trashcan used by KDE, GNOME, and XFCE, but you
can invoke it from the command line (and scripts).
It provides these commands:
trash-put trash files and directories.
trash-empty empty the trashcan(s).
trash-list list trashed files.
trash-restore restore a trashed file.
trash-rm remove individual files from the trashcan.

deskutils/R-cran-exams: New port: automatic generation of exams
Automatic generation of exams based on exercises in Markdown or LaTeX format,
possibly including R code for dynamic generation of exercise elements.
Exercise types include single-choice and multiple-choice questions,
arithmetic problems, string questions, and combinations thereof (cloze).
Output formats include standalone files (PDF, HTML, Docx, ODT, ...), Moodle XML,
QTI 1.2, QTI 2.1, Blackboard, Canvas, OpenOlat, ILIAS, TestVision, Particify,
ARSnova, Kahoot!, Grasple, and TCExam.
In addition to fully customizable PDF exams, a standardized PDF format (NOPS)
is provided that can be printed, scanned, and automatically evaluated.

deskutils/xdg-desktop-portal-lxqt: New port: Portal frontend service for LXQT
Flatpak is a technology for packaging and distributing standalone dekstop
applications. It uses interfaces called "portals" to communicate with the
rest of the system.
xdg-desktop-portal works by exposing a series of D-Bus interfaces known as
portals under a well-known name (org.freedesktop.portal.Desktop) and object
path (/org/freedesktop/portal/desktop). The portal interfaces include APIs for
file access, opening URIs, printing and others.

deskutils/libportal: split into slave ports corresponding to GUI backend
The port has been splitted into 1 master and 3 slave ports for those
who want only a subset of the supported backends and don't want
excessive dependency, namely:
- deskutils/libportal: common non-GUI part (master port)
- deskutils/libportal-gtk3: gtk3 backend
- deskutils/libportal-gtk4: gtk4 backend
- deskutils/libportal-qt5: qt5 backend
While here, correct license and make dependency adjustments of
consumer ports.

deskutils/subsurface: New port
Subsurface can plan and track single and multi-tank dives using air, Nitrox or
TriMix. It allows tracking of dive locations including GPS coordinates (which
can also conveniently be entered using a map interface), logging of equipment
used and names of other divers, and lets users rate dives and provide
additional notes.
You can tag dives and filter a dive list based on criteria including tags,
locations and people with whom you were diving. You can group the dive list
into trips, and edit multiple dives at the same time, making it easy to support
a large number of dives.
Subsurface also calculates a wide variety of statistics of the user's diving
and tracks information like the SAC rate, partial pressures of O2, N2 and He,
calculated deco information, and many more.
